Passage 4 is moderate while passage 5 is the hardest question among all. Grammar - The difficulty level for this section is ... Here’s the real problem with the June SAT curve. When College Board’s equating makes it that missing 1 math question on the June SAT is equal to missing 3 on another SAT, they are suggesting that the same person has enough knowledge to only miss 1 on the June test, and with that same knowledge, he/she would miss 3 on another given test. Your total score is a number between 400 and 1600. The total score is the sum of your scores on the Reading and Writing section and the Math section. Each of these two section scores is in the range of 200-800. Both sections contribute equally to the total score.346K subscribers in the Sat community. Since College Board and most students use the term "curve" for this process, I'll stick with it. ...Some students and parents confuse "equating" with "grading on a curve," but it's not the same thing. When a test is scored on a curve, the score may change depending on how everyone else performed on the test. A student's SAT score is based only on how they perform and is never affected by another student's performance.June SAT curve discussion. Test Preparation. Jul 17, 2018 · How the June SAT Falls Short. Compare this to how the June SAT 2018 Math fits in among its fellow new SATs. A 650 could be achieved with 50 correct answers. That’s the lowest scaled score the new SAT has ever produced for 50 correct answers. The highest score it has produced for 50 correct answers on an actual, released exam is 740 points ...
